    Winter will make the doklam region ( where my country India's troops are confronting Chinese troops ) snowbound as it is situated at 15000 feet above sea level , making military operations impossible for months. So whatever military action has to take place, it has to happen in the next few weeks.

    I don't know, China's military might be under some recruiting strain:

    Young Chinese are ‘too fat and masturbate too much to pass army fitness tests.’

    A rising number of young Chinese people are failing fitness tests required to join the army because they are too fat and masturbate too much, state media has proclaimed.

    The high rejection rate has triggered concerns that there are not enough youths in good physical condition to fill the ranks of the Chinese army.

    A poor diet and frequent masturbation, leading to abnormally large testicular veins, are believed to be behind falling fitness levels, according to a report published in state-run military newspaper the People’s Liberation Army Daily.

    Authorities also think the constant use of smartphones and drinking water with too high a mineral content are to blame.

    In one city, 56.9 per cent of potential recruits were rejected after failing fitness tests. One in five was simply deemed too fat.
